It’s not too late for Justin Bieber to say sorry.Ā 

In honor of Valentine’s Day, Hailey Bieber shared a cheeky message that hinted at her being mad at the “Sorry” singerā€”but having a hard time staying angry.Ā 

Hailey reshared a cartoon video to her Instagram Story Feb. 14, showing the grey cat Topsy from Tom & Jerry scurrying across the floor while clenching his fists and squinting his eyes in frustration. Alongside the clip, a caption read, “When you’re mad at him, and he says ‘come here, baby.'”

And while Hailey didn’t specify why she might be upset with Justin, the 28-year-old did add her own sweet reaction to the meme by including two heart emojis above the video.Ā Ā 

Plus, she re-posted Justin’s separate tribute to her in honor of the holiday, which included several photobooth snaps of the couple in front of a white background. Alongside his Instagram, the Grammy winner, 30, captioned the adorable carousel, “HAPPY VALENTINES DAY FROM THE BIEBERS.”

As for who didn’t make an appearance in Hailey or Justin’s Valentine’s Day tributes? Their 5-month-old son Jack Blues Bieber.Ā 

But that shouldn’t be a total surprise. After all, the coupleā€”who have sparked breakup speculation over the last several monthsā€”have kept the little one mostly out of the spotlight since welcoming him back in August.Ā 

Photo by Emma McIntyre/Getty Images for Academy Museum of Motion Pictures / Photo by Raymond Hall/GC Images

For Hailey, the decision to keep their parenting journey private was born out of feeling hurt by criticism of her marriage after she and Justin tied the knot in 2018.

“It’s enough that people say things about my husband or my friends,” she told The Sunday Times in 2023. “I can’t imagine having to confront people saying things about a child.”Ā 

But the Rhode Skin founder insisted that public scrutiny wouldn’t stop her from expanding her family. As she put it, “We can only do the best we can to raise them, as long as they feel loved and safe.”
